文章 2025-01-15 来自:开发者社区

SpringBoot集成Shiro权限+Jwt认证

背景 为什么要使用Shiro? 随大流吧,虽然自己也可以基于自定义注解+拦截器实现和Shiro一样的功能,但是为了适用于业界的规范,所以集成这个大家都能看得懂,而且Shiro也相对简单。 为什么要用Jwt? 传统的session模式越来越少,而且大多数系统都是微服务多客户端的,所以无状态...

SpringBoot集成Shiro权限+Jwt认证
阿里云文档 2023-04-19

问题描述ElasticSearch无法集成SpringBoot。问题原因目前,阿里云ElasticSearch官方尚未提供SpringBoot集成示例。解决方案阿里云ElasticSearch提供了X-Pack的安全验证方式,SpringBoot集成示例,请参见Java示例或在线的示例方案。Java...

文章 2022-06-13 来自:开发者社区

SpringBoot Security 集成JWT实现接口可信赖认证(下)

create Token方法使用jjwt库创建JWT令牌。用户名就是有效负载的主题。它是使用属性文件中的密钥签名的,并且令牌的有效性也在属性文件中指定。结果令牌将具有Header.Payload.Signature的格式。标头包含类型(JSON Web令牌)和哈希算法(HMAC SHA256)。有效负载又称包含令牌的主题(子),数字日期值(exp)中的到期日期,发布JWT的时间(iat),唯一的....

SpringBoot Security 集成JWT实现接口可信赖认证(下)
文章 2022-06-13 来自:开发者社区

SpringBoot Security 集成JWT实现接口可信赖认证(中)

开发配置类用于自定义拦截配置package com.example.demo.config; import org.springframework.beans.factory.annotation.Autowired; import org.springframework.context.annotation.Bean; import org.springframework.context.an....

SpringBoot Security 集成JWT实现接口可信赖认证(中)
文章 2022-06-13 来自:开发者社区

SpringBoot Security 集成JWT实现接口可信赖认证(上)

快速创建应用采用Springboot、Maven、jdk8,快速创建一个Web应用。基础访问类编写package com.example.demo.controller; import org.springframework.web.bind.annotation.GetMapping; import org.springframework.web.bind.annotation.Request....

SpringBoot Security 集成JWT实现接口可信赖认证(上)

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

微服务

构建可靠、高效、易扩展的技术基石

+关注